GITNUXSOFTWARE ADVICE
Finance Financial ServicesTop 10 Best Financial Record Keeping Software of 2026
How we ranked these tools
Core product claims cross-referenced against official documentation, changelogs, and independent technical reviews.
Analyzed video reviews and hundreds of written evaluations to capture real-world user experiences with each tool.
AI persona simulations modeled how different user types would experience each tool across common use cases and workflows.
Final rankings reviewed and approved by our editorial team with authority to override AI-generated scores based on domain expertise.
Score: Features 40% · Ease 30% · Value 30%
Gitnux may earn a commission through links on this page — this does not influence rankings. Editorial policy
Editor’s top 3 picks
Three quick recommendations before you dive into the full comparison below — each one leads on a different dimension.
QuickBooks Online
Smart bank transaction matching and rules-based automation for near-effortless reconciliation and categorization
Built for small to medium-sized businesses and freelancers needing scalable, professional-grade financial record keeping with real-time insights..
GnuCash
Strict double-entry accounting that automatically balances books and prevents errors in complex financial records
Built for tech-savvy users or small business owners comfortable with double-entry bookkeeping who need a no-cost, feature-rich desktop solution for detailed financial tracking..
FreshBooks
Automated invoicing with customizable templates, late payment reminders, and integrated online payments to accelerate collections
Built for freelancers and small service-based businesses seeking simple, automated financial record keeping without complex accounting needs..
Comparison Table
Financial record-keeping software simplifies managing finances, from tracking income to generating reports, and the right tool varies by business needs. This comparison table explores top options—including QuickBooks Online, Xero, FreshBooks, Zoho Books, Wave, and more—to help readers identify software that aligns with their size, industry, and workflow.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| QuickBooks Online Cloud-based accounting software that automates invoicing, expense tracking, payroll, and financial reporting for small to medium businesses. | enterprise | 9.6/10 | 9.8/10 | 9.2/10 | 9.1/10 |
| 2 | Xero Cloud accounting platform for reconciling bank transactions, managing invoices, expenses, and generating real-time financial reports. | enterprise | 9.2/10 | 9.5/10 | 9.0/10 | 8.7/10 |
| 3 | FreshBooks User-friendly invoicing and bookkeeping software tailored for freelancers and small service-based businesses to track time, expenses, and payments. | specialized | 8.4/10 | 8.2/10 | 9.5/10 | 7.8/10 |
| 4 | Zoho Books Affordable online accounting solution with inventory management, multi-currency support, and seamless integrations for growing businesses. | enterprise | 8.7/10 | 9.0/10 | 8.5/10 | 9.2/10 |
| 5 | Wave Free cloud-based accounting tool offering unlimited invoicing, receipt scanning, and basic financial reporting for solopreneurs and startups. | specialized | 8.8/10 | 8.5/10 | 9.5/10 | 9.8/10 |
| 6 | Sage Intacct Scalable cloud financial management software for mid-sized businesses with advanced reporting, multi-entity support, and automation. | enterprise | 8.6/10 | 9.2/10 | 7.4/10 | 8.1/10 |
| 7 | NetSuite Comprehensive cloud ERP system including financial record keeping, CRM, and inventory management for large enterprises. | enterprise | 8.2/10 | 9.4/10 | 6.8/10 | 7.5/10 |
| 8 | Quicken Desktop and mobile personal finance software for tracking transactions, budgets, investments, and generating reports for individuals. | other | 8.2/10 | 9.1/10 | 7.4/10 | 8.0/10 |
| 9 | Manager.io Free, open-source desktop accounting software for double-entry bookkeeping, invoicing, and customizable financial statements. | specialized | 8.7/10 | 9.2/10 | 8.0/10 | 9.8/10 |
| 10 | GnuCash Free open-source accounting program for personal and small business use with double-entry accounting and transaction scheduling. | other | 8.1/10 | 9.2/10 | 6.3/10 | 10/10 |
Cloud-based accounting software that automates invoicing, expense tracking, payroll, and financial reporting for small to medium businesses.
Cloud accounting platform for reconciling bank transactions, managing invoices, expenses, and generating real-time financial reports.
User-friendly invoicing and bookkeeping software tailored for freelancers and small service-based businesses to track time, expenses, and payments.
Affordable online accounting solution with inventory management, multi-currency support, and seamless integrations for growing businesses.
Free cloud-based accounting tool offering unlimited invoicing, receipt scanning, and basic financial reporting for solopreneurs and startups.
Scalable cloud financial management software for mid-sized businesses with advanced reporting, multi-entity support, and automation.
Comprehensive cloud ERP system including financial record keeping, CRM, and inventory management for large enterprises.
Desktop and mobile personal finance software for tracking transactions, budgets, investments, and generating reports for individuals.
Free, open-source desktop accounting software for double-entry bookkeeping, invoicing, and customizable financial statements.
Free open-source accounting program for personal and small business use with double-entry accounting and transaction scheduling.
QuickBooks Online
enterpriseCloud-based accounting software that automates invoicing, expense tracking, payroll, and financial reporting for small to medium businesses.
Smart bank transaction matching and rules-based automation for near-effortless reconciliation and categorization
QuickBooks Online is a leading cloud-based accounting software from Intuit, designed primarily for small to medium-sized businesses to handle financial record keeping with precision and efficiency. It provides comprehensive tools for invoicing, expense tracking, bank reconciliations, payroll management, and generating detailed financial reports, all accessible via web or mobile apps. The platform automates many manual tasks, ensures audit-ready records, and integrates seamlessly with banks and third-party apps to streamline bookkeeping workflows.
Pros
- Robust automation for bank feeds, categorization, and reconciliations
- Extensive reporting and customizable dashboards for accurate record keeping
- Strong security features and audit trail for compliance
Cons
- Higher-tier plans can be costly for very small businesses
- Learning curve for advanced features like inventory or project tracking
- Customer support can be slow during peak times
Best For
Small to medium-sized businesses and freelancers needing scalable, professional-grade financial record keeping with real-time insights.
Xero
enterpriseCloud accounting platform for reconciling bank transactions, managing invoices, expenses, and generating real-time financial reports.
Direct bank feeds from 20,000+ institutions with AI-powered reconciliation for near-instant, accurate transaction recording
Xero is a cloud-based accounting software tailored for small to medium-sized businesses, providing comprehensive tools for financial record keeping including invoicing, bank reconciliation, expense tracking, and financial reporting. It automates transaction categorization through direct bank feeds from thousands of institutions, ensuring accurate and real-time record maintenance. With multi-currency support, fixed asset tracking, and compliance-ready reporting, Xero streamlines bookkeeping while integrating seamlessly with over 1,000 third-party apps.
Pros
- Automatic bank feeds and unlimited reconciliations for effortless transaction matching
- Real-time dashboards and customizable reports for precise financial oversight
- Extensive integrations with CRM, payroll, and inventory tools to centralize records
Cons
- Pricing escalates quickly for advanced features and multi-user access
- Customer support limited to email/chat on entry-level plans, no phone
- Some region-specific features like payroll require add-ons or partners
Best For
Small to medium-sized businesses needing scalable, cloud-based financial record keeping with strong automation and global compliance.
FreshBooks
specializedUser-friendly invoicing and bookkeeping software tailored for freelancers and small service-based businesses to track time, expenses, and payments.
Automated invoicing with customizable templates, late payment reminders, and integrated online payments to accelerate collections
FreshBooks is a cloud-based accounting platform tailored for small businesses, freelancers, and service providers, focusing on streamlined invoicing, expense tracking, time tracking, and basic financial reporting. It automates billing processes, tracks income and expenses, and generates essential reports like profit and loss statements to simplify financial record keeping. Ideal for users who need user-friendly tools without deep accounting expertise, it integrates payments and client management for efficient cash flow oversight.
Pros
- Intuitive interface that's easy for non-accountants to use
- Robust invoicing with automation, recurring bills, and payment reminders
- Solid expense tracking and basic reporting for profit/loss and taxes
Cons
- Limited advanced accounting features like inventory management or double-entry bookkeeping
- Pricing scales quickly with client volume, becoming expensive for growing teams
- Reporting lacks deep customization compared to enterprise tools
Best For
Freelancers and small service-based businesses seeking simple, automated financial record keeping without complex accounting needs.
Zoho Books
enterpriseAffordable online accounting solution with inventory management, multi-currency support, and seamless integrations for growing businesses.
Automatic bank feeds with AI-powered transaction categorization for effortless and error-free record maintenance
Zoho Books is a cloud-based accounting platform designed for small to medium-sized businesses, providing comprehensive tools for financial record keeping including invoicing, expense tracking, bank reconciliation, and automated journal entries. It generates key financial statements such as balance sheets, profit and loss reports, and cash flow statements with real-time updates. The software supports multi-currency transactions, inventory tracking, and compliance features like GST/VAT handling, making it ideal for maintaining accurate and organized financial records.
Pros
- Robust financial reporting and automation for accurate record keeping
- Seamless bank reconciliation with automatic transaction imports
- Affordable pricing with a free tier for small operations
Cons
- Advanced inventory management requires higher plans
- Customer support response times can vary
- Steeper learning curve for complex customizations
Best For
Small businesses and freelancers seeking an affordable, scalable solution for daily financial record keeping and compliance.
Wave
specializedFree cloud-based accounting tool offering unlimited invoicing, receipt scanning, and basic financial reporting for solopreneurs and startups.
Unlimited free invoicing and accounting with no caps on customers, transactions, or users
Wave is a cloud-based financial management platform tailored for small businesses, freelancers, and solopreneurs, providing essential tools for invoicing, expense tracking, bank reconciliation, and generating financial reports. It excels in simple record keeping by automating categorization of transactions, scanning receipts via mobile app, and offering customizable reports like profit & loss and balance sheets. The software integrates payments and payroll (in select regions), making it a one-stop solution for basic bookkeeping without upfront costs.
Pros
- Completely free core accounting and unlimited invoicing
- Intuitive dashboard and mobile app for easy record keeping
- Automatic bank feeds and receipt scanning for accurate tracking
Cons
- Payment processing incurs transaction fees (2.9% + $0.30)
- Limited advanced features like inventory management
- Payroll available only in US and Canada with extra costs
Best For
Freelancers and very small businesses needing a free, straightforward tool for daily financial record keeping and basic invoicing.
Sage Intacct
enterpriseScalable cloud financial management software for mid-sized businesses with advanced reporting, multi-entity support, and automation.
True multi-entity management with intercompany eliminations and consolidations
Sage Intacct is a cloud-based financial management platform designed for mid-sized businesses, offering comprehensive tools for general ledger, accounts payable/receivable, cash management, and financial reporting. It excels in automating record-keeping processes with real-time dashboards and multi-dimensional tracking for accurate financial records. The software supports multi-entity management, making it suitable for organizations with multiple locations or subsidiaries, while ensuring compliance with GAAP and other standards.
Pros
- Robust multi-entity and multi-book accounting for complex organizations
- Advanced reporting and analytics with customizable dashboards
- Strong automation for AP/AR, GL, and bank reconciliation
Cons
- Steep learning curve and complex initial setup requiring professional services
- Higher pricing that may not suit smaller businesses
- Limited out-of-the-box customization without developer involvement
Best For
Mid-sized businesses or nonprofits with multiple entities needing scalable, compliant financial record-keeping.
NetSuite
enterpriseComprehensive cloud ERP system including financial record keeping, CRM, and inventory management for large enterprises.
Real-time financial consolidation across subsidiaries with a unified data model
NetSuite is a cloud-based ERP platform from Oracle that offers comprehensive financial management tools, including general ledger, accounts payable/receivable, fixed assets, and advanced financial reporting. It automates record-keeping, ensures compliance with standards like GAAP and IFRS, and provides real-time dashboards for financial insights. Designed for scalability, it integrates financial data with CRM, inventory, and e-commerce modules for holistic business visibility.
Pros
- Comprehensive financial reporting and analytics with customizable dashboards
- Strong multi-entity and multi-currency support for global operations
- Automated compliance and audit trails for accurate record-keeping
Cons
- High implementation costs and complexity
- Steep learning curve for non-expert users
- Expensive for small businesses or basic needs
Best For
Mid-sized to large enterprises needing scalable, integrated financial record-keeping within a full ERP system.
Quicken
otherDesktop and mobile personal finance software for tracking transactions, budgets, investments, and generating reports for individuals.
Advanced investment portfolio management with real-time quotes, cost basis tracking, and performance benchmarking
Quicken is a veteran personal finance software designed for detailed tracking of transactions, budgets, investments, and net worth across bank, credit card, and investment accounts. It automates data imports from financial institutions, offers customizable categories and tags for precise record-keeping, and generates comprehensive reports for tax preparation and financial analysis. While primarily a desktop application, it includes mobile apps for on-the-go access and syncing.
Pros
- Extensive transaction categorization and reconciliation tools for accurate record-keeping
- Powerful reporting and customization options including tax schedules
- Strong support for investment tracking with performance analytics
Cons
- Steep learning curve due to dense interface and advanced features
- Limited mobile functionality compared to web-based competitors
- Subscription model without perpetual license option increases long-term costs
Best For
Experienced users or investors needing detailed, long-term financial record-keeping and reporting beyond simple budgeting.
Manager.io
specializedFree, open-source desktop accounting software for double-entry bookkeeping, invoicing, and customizable financial statements.
Unlimited, subscription-free usage with open-source code for full customization and data ownership
Manager.io is a free, open-source desktop accounting software tailored for small businesses, freelancers, and self-employed professionals. It provides comprehensive double-entry bookkeeping, including invoicing, expense tracking, inventory management, purchase orders, and customizable financial reports. The software supports multi-currency transactions, project tracking, and manufacturing modules, allowing users to handle complex financial records entirely offline with no usage limits.
Pros
- Completely free with unlimited users, companies, and transactions
- Robust feature set including inventory, projects, and multi-currency support
- Fully offline desktop app with strong data privacy and no vendor lock-in
Cons
- Desktop-only with no native mobile app
- Cloud hosting requires paid subscription and self-setup for advanced users
- Steeper learning curve for non-accountants due to double-entry system
Best For
Small businesses and freelancers seeking powerful, cost-free financial record-keeping that prioritizes privacy and offline access.
GnuCash
otherFree open-source accounting program for personal and small business use with double-entry accounting and transaction scheduling.
Strict double-entry accounting that automatically balances books and prevents errors in complex financial records
GnuCash is a free, open-source desktop application for personal and small-business financial accounting, utilizing a double-entry bookkeeping system to track income, expenses, assets, liabilities, and investments. It supports multiple currencies, stock and mutual fund tracking, budgeting, scheduled transactions, and generates detailed reports and graphs. Cross-platform compatibility on Windows, macOS, and Linux makes it accessible for users seeking robust local financial record-keeping without ongoing costs.
Pros
- Completely free and open-source with no ads or subscriptions
- Powerful double-entry accounting with support for stocks, multi-currency, and complex transactions
- Extensive reporting, budgeting, and graphing tools
Cons
- Steep learning curve, especially for beginners unfamiliar with accounting principles
- Dated, clunky user interface lacking modern polish
- No native cloud sync, mobile apps, or real-time collaboration
Best For
Tech-savvy users or small business owners comfortable with double-entry bookkeeping who need a no-cost, feature-rich desktop solution for detailed financial tracking.
Conclusion
After evaluating 10 finance financial services, QuickBooks Online stands out as our overall top pick — it scored highest across our combined criteria of features, ease of use, and value, which is why it sits at #1 in the rankings above.
Use the comparison table and detailed reviews above to validate the fit against your own requirements before committing to a tool.
Tools reviewed
Referenced in the comparison table and product reviews above.
Keep exploring
Comparing two specific tools?
Software Alternatives
See head-to-head software comparisons with feature breakdowns, pricing, and our recommendation for each use case.
Explore software alternatives →In this category
Finance Financial Services alternatives
See side-by-side comparisons of finance financial services tools and pick the right one for your stack.
Compare finance financial services tools →